Ukrainian FPV drones continue to play a critical role in the conflict against Russian occupiers, with successful operations reported from various regions. The 414th Brigade "Madyar's Birds" eliminated multiple enemy combatants in the Pokrovsk direction. Special Operations Forces effectively targeted the Russian unmanned technology centre "Rubicon" in Mangush. Simultaneously, drone units from different brigades, such as the 142nd Separate Mechanised Brigade and the 225th Special Forces Battalion, deployed their drones to neutralize threats and secure strategic advantage. These operations highlight the ongoing advancements and tactical utilisation of drones in the Ukrainian military strategy, effectively disrupting enemy positions and logistics.
